1762570389880507522457748791137499002
Even
1762570389880507522457748791137499002 is even
Previous even number is 1762570389880507522457748791137499000
Next even number is 1762570389880507522457748791137499004
Cubed
5475697020517747507730599981090850337883318012297646506183905232929705982588771895197084841800591842655988008
Squared
3106654379283524294526854542823685728659987126844827772877319139550996004
Binary
1010100110111010101101101111110001111000100101111111000001100101011011011100101010001100101011100111001010111011101111010